A technician needs to boot a laptop from a USB drive to run a diagnostic tool. The USB is plugged in but the system skips it and boots from the internal SSD. Which UEFI setting is most likely preventing the USB boot?

- ✓
Disable Secure Boot
Why this is correct
Secure Boot is a UEFI firmware feature designed to enhance system security by preventing the loading of unauthorized operating systems or drivers during the boot process. It validates the digital signature of bootloaders and kernel modules against a database of trusted keys. When attempting to boot from a diagnostic USB drive or other external media that lacks a valid, trusted digital signature, Secure Boot will typically block the operation, necessitating its disablement to proceed.
- ✗
Enable Fast Boot
Why it's wrong here
Fast Boot, also known as Quick Boot or Ultra Fast Boot, is a UEFI setting that optimizes the boot process by skipping certain hardware initialization steps, such as memory tests or USB device enumeration, during startup. While it can reduce the time it takes for the system to reach the operating system, enabling it does not inherently prevent or facilitate booting from a specifically chosen USB device. It primarily affects the speed of the internal boot sequence, not the ability to select an external boot source.
- ✗
Set SATA mode to RAID
Why it's wrong here
Setting the SATA mode to RAID (Redundant Array of Independent Disks) configures how the system's SATA controller interacts with connected storage devices, specifically for creating disk arrays. This setting is entirely concerned with the management and performance of internal hard drives or solid-state drives, not with the selection or enablement of external boot devices like a USB drive. Changing the SATA mode would not impact the ability to boot from a USB.
- ✗
Disable the TPM
Why it's wrong here
The Trusted Platform Module (TPM) is a dedicated microcontroller designed to secure hardware by integrating cryptographic keys into devices. Its primary functions include generating, storing, and limiting the use of cryptographic keys, as well as platform integrity measurements for features like BitLocker drive encryption. Disabling the TPM would not affect the system's ability to recognize or boot from an external USB device, as it is unrelated to boot order or device enumeration.

UEFI
UEFI (Unified Extensible Firmware Interface) is a modern firmware interface that initializes hardware and boots the operating system, replacing the older BIOS.
